Things might turn out just fine, but I would like to prevent a problem
here (being a pediatrician, I intervene).  I would get this mother
expressing her milk, and if there is only a little, mix it with sugar
water and get the baby drinking (I prefer finger feeding because it is
an easy way to wake up a sleepy baby, and get him sucking well).  As the
baby wakens more and more, he should start taking the breast better.

Jack Newman, MD, FRCPC
